Six shops damaged in Batamaloo fire incident

SRINAGAR: At least six shops were destroyed in a devastating fire incident in Batamaloo area of Srinagar on Thursday late evening.

Reports said that five to six shops have completely damaged. However, it was not immediately known whether the shops were set on fire or the incident happened accidently. Local reports suggest that smoke and flames appeared near the shops around 9:00 in the evening. However, after the arrival of Fire and Emergency men the fire was somehow controlled by them.

Meanwhile police have taken the cognizance of the incident and further investigations are going on.
